Output 85029ccccaaa1836c3c92fc2dd148251497590446553558c126624900fc0d195:3

value
20340266
script pubkey
OP_0 OP_PUSHBYTES_20 95f9a8b28dd1c65841f2107deea00bf575b1a688
address
ltc1qjhu63v5d68r9ss0jzp77agqt746mrf5gjprkc8
transaction
85029ccccaaa1836c3c92fc2dd148251497590446553558c126624900fc0d195
spent
true